In the last few weeks, there has been quite a bit of talk around Alessandro Bastoni and a possible move to Barcelona. Serie A giants Inter would obviously be perturbed by the speculation, especially since the defender hasn’t had a great few months.
Bastoni was given a standing ovation during Inter’s win over Roma. It was probably a sign of the restoration of love between the two parties.
Nerazzurri sporting director Piero Ausilio spoke about the defender at an event at Coverciano today. In a chat with **FCInterNews** – via [Calciomercato](http://www.calciomercato.com/notizie/inter-ausilio-barcellona-su-bastoni-non-devono-parlare-chi-lo-vuole-ci-chiami/blt8801a28e64049b5d), he clarified that Barcelona haven’t come forward for the player and they know the phone numbers, if they want to do that.
He said: _“Bastoni has a contract with Inter, and there aren’t any situations right now that suggest Bastoni will leave Inter. Barcelona? I don’t know what they’re saying in Spain, but we’re happy with what Bastoni has given to Inter, and we’re sure he’ll give a lot more._
Ausilio also urged the Spanish media to shut down and focus on what is really going on.
_“If anyone is interested in Bastoni, they know the phone numbers, so they should do that, they shouldn’t talk.”_
So far, there have been a variety of rumours about Bastoni. Some have suggested he would be interested in a move to Barcelona, with others appearing certain he is keen on staying at Inter. It is fair to say that the next ew weeks will define everything.
